Interesting fact
One interesting fact about this coin is that it features a unique design, showcasing a fragment of the Villa of Mysteries Fresco, which is an ancient Roman fresco from the Villa of the Mysteries in Pompeii, Italy. The fresco depicts a scene from ancient Greek mythology, specifically the initiation of a young woman into the cult of Dionysus. The coin's design is a rare representation of this famous fresco on a numismatic item, making it a highly sought-after collector's item for coin enthusiasts and art lovers alike.
